构造和析构方法?功能是?
2017-06-08 11:06
260 查看
构造方法:每个类至少有一个构造方法,类初始化时调用的方法
1.方法名和类名相同
2.无返回值类型
格式:访问权限 类名(参数列表) {};
1.自己定义构造后,就没有默认的构造方法
2.无构造方法时,默认为空参的构造方法(无参数,方法体为空)
析构方法:finalize
类销毁时,自动调用方法
当对象在内存中被删除时,自动调用该方法
在此方法中可以写回收对象内部的动态空间的代码
1.方法名和类名相同
2.无返回值类型
格式:访问权限 类名(参数列表) {};
1.自己定义构造后,就没有默认的构造方法
2.无构造方法时,默认为空参的构造方法(无参数,方法体为空)
析构方法:finalize
类销毁时,自动调用方法
当对象在内存中被删除时,自动调用该方法
在此方法中可以写回收对象内部的动态空间的代码
相关文章推荐
- 什么是构造和析构方法?功能是?接
- 什么是构造和析构方法?功能是?
- (教学思路 C#之类四)构造方法(静态构造方法、this、方法重载)、析构方法(修改新增)
- 继承类的构造和析构方法
- Android JNI开发高级篇有关Android JNI开发中比较强大和有用的功能就是从JNI层创建、构造Java的类或执行Java层的方法获取属性等操作。 一、类的相关操作 1. jclass FindClass(JNIEnv *env, const char *name);
- php 面向对象编程之构造方法与析构方法
- 类的声明与实例化及构造方法析构方法(PHP学习)
- 理解 Delphi 的类(十一) - 深入类中的方法[10] - 构造方法与析构方法
- PHP的构造方法,析构方法和this关键字
- 学习PHP面向对象(二)构造方法与析构方法
- (38)面向对象的构造与析构方法(39)面向对象的三大特性之一封装性
- PHP的构造方法,析构方法和this关键字详细介绍
- php面向对象全攻略 (四)构造方法与析构方法
- php学习笔记------[面向对象的构造与析构方法]
- php学习笔记 面向对象的构造与析构方法
- 构造方法、析构方法是如何定义的
- PHP5 构造方法与析构方法
- 构造方法与析构方法
- php学习笔记 面向对象的构造与析构方法
- python面向对象开发3 (内部类-构造-析构)魔术方法)